Understanding Product Lifecycle Management
Product Lifecycle Management is a strategic approach to managing the flow of information about a product. It connects people, data, processes, and business systems. The goal is to provide the right information to the right person at the right time. This framework supports collaboration across departments, including engineering, manufacturing, sales, and marketing.

Centralized Data Management
A PLM platform acts as a secure repository for all product-related data. This includes CAD files, bill of materials, specifications, and documentation. By maintaining a single source of truth, these systems eliminate errors caused by version control issues. Teams can access the latest approved information instantly.
Workflow Automation
These solutions excel at automating the sequential steps required to bring a product to market. Approval processes, change management, and release cycles are handled digitally. This reduces manual intervention and accelerates time to market significantly.
Feature | Benefit | Impact
Version Control | Eliminates confusion over document iterations | Reduces errors and rework
Change Management | Streamlines approval processes | Shortens development cycles
Bill of Materials | Provides accurate component tracking | Improves sourcing and inventory
Implementation and Integration Strategy
A successful deployment requires careful planning beyond just the software installation. Data migration from legacy systems must be handled with care. Integration with existing ERPs, CAD tools, and MES is critical for seamless operations. The system should complement, not disrupt, the current tech stack. Measuring Return on Investment
Organizations often struggle to quantify the value of a PLM system. Key performance indicators provide clarity. Metrics such as reduced development time, lower scrap rates, and faster new product introductions demonstrate tangible benefits.
